Ethereum’s Vitalik Buterin Proposes ‘Stealth Address’ System to Enhance Blockchain Privacy – Here’s How it Works

Source: Pixabay

Ethereum creator Vitalik Buterin has proposed a brand new “stealth deal with” system for Ethereum that may dramatically enhance and simplify the workflow for attaining privateness for peculiar customers.

According to a weblog post printed by Buterin over the weekend and titled An incomplete information to stealth addresses, the proposed system would deliver the identical privateness properties as producing new addresses for every transaction somebody receives.

The solely distinction could be that this could occur with none work wanted for the receiver.

Privacy stays a big problem on Ethereum

In the weblog put up, Buterin admitted that privateness – or the shortage thereof – is a big drawback for Ethereum customers, saying:

“One of the biggest remaining challenges within the Ethereum ecosystem is privateness. By default, something that goes onto a public blockchain is public […] In follow, utilizing the complete suite of Ethereum functions includes making a good portion of your life public for anybody to see and analyze.”

He added that bettering this case for customers is “well known” as an necessary drawback that builders ought to work on.

Secret spending keys and stealth meta-addresses

Specifically, the system proposed by Buterin would work by having wallets generate so-called stealth meta-addresses for receiving funds utilizing a secret “spending key” that solely the receiving occasion in a transaction has entry to. The stealth deal with is then shared with the sender, who should additionally publish a chunk of cryptographic knowledge referred to as an ephemeral pubkey on-chain for the receiver to perceive that the deal with belongs to him.

To allow the era of each the key spending key and the general public stealth meta-address, Buterin proposed to use a system often known as the Diffie-Hellman key exchange. According to Buterin, this technique is a foundational a part of trendy cryptography, and would accomplish precisely what is required for stealth addresses to be carried out on Ethereum.

The Ethereum founder went on to share an in depth illustration of the workflow with the brand new system:


Zero-knowledge proofs

In conclusion, the Ethereum creator admitted that stealth addresses do introduce “some longer-term usability considerations,” together with issues round so-called “social restoration” of misplaced keys. He stated that these considerations might be merely accepted for now, however made it clear {that a} extra lasting resolution will doubtless rely “actually closely” on zero-knowledge (ZK) proofs.

Recommended For You

About the Author: Daniel